To experience the rich cultural heritage and traditions of West-Telemark, Vest-Telemark Museum Eidsborg is an excellent place to start.
The museum consists of a collection of more than 30 buildings, an open air museum with one of Norway’s oldest pagan wooden buildings, the famous Eidsborg stave church dated back to the 12th century and a new, modern museum building with several exhibitions.
Our cafe is open every day in the season. The rest of the year we are open for booking. The cafe serves both traditional and international dishes, all made in our kitchen.
There are several marked foot paths with West Telemark Museum Eidsborg as starting point.
There are many blockhouse constructions among the buildings at the museum, a building technique still in use.
